African Banks Break $100 Billion Revenue Barrier for First Time
South Africa, Nigeria, Egypt, Morocco, and Kenya lead the sector, accounting for about 70% of $107 billion continental banking revenue, according to McKinsey data cited by SABC.
African banks also boast one of the world's highest profitability levels—19% return on equity in 2024, compared to the global average of 10%.
